Description
The accommodation comprises Entrance Hall, Living Room with inglenook fireplace and woodburner, Dining Room, Fitted Kitchen / Dining / Breakfast Room with Aga, Rangemaster and French doors to garden, Pantry, Utility Room, Shower Room, Rear Hall with door to garden, Master Bedroom with storage and wash basin, Bedroom 2 with fitted wardrobe and Ensuite Shower Room, 2 further bedrooms and Family Bathroom.
Situated in this small hamlet within 1.9 miles of the centre of Wellington and 5.2 miles to Taunton town centre.
Wellington offers an excellent range of local amenities including a variety of independent shops, supermarkets including Waitrose and Co-Op, sport and leisure facilities and a selection of schools, both primary and secondary including Wellington School.
Taunton is a bustling, forward-looking town with excellent amenities, a good selection of independent and high street shops, distinctive restaurants, cafés, a wealth of history and sporting facilities including the County Cricket Ground.
Taunton benefits from a main line railway station linking to London Paddington in less than 2 hours and excellent communications for the M5 motorway at Junction 26 less than 2 miles away.
